YOUNG ADULT TRANSITION CENTER OFFICE ADMINISTRATIVE ASSISTANT
Deadline: August 31, 2026
District/Organization: St. Joseph County ISD
Position/Type: Other, full time
Salary: $16.03-$17.39
Position Details
Qualifications:
- Minimum 1-year of related office support experience; school office experience preferred but not required.
- Working knowledge of computers and software, especially Google Apps and Microsoft Office Suite.
- Ability to handle confidential information.
- Ability to work independently and as a part of a team.
- Experience or interest in working with individuals with disabilities and/or young adults a plus, not required.
- Responsibility of employee to obtain and maintain all training(s), certificate(s), approval(s), etc. and provide documentation to the business office before expiration date of said document(s).
- Must be able to lift up to 20 pounds.
- Required to have a physical presence at the designated job site each scheduled work day.
- Must have regular and reliable job attendance, performance and the physical ability to do the job.
Performance Responsibilities:
- Provide office assistance to the Young Adult Transition Center (YATC), which includes interacting with parents/guardians, staff, students, and other professional in a professional manner in person, by phone or by email.
- Assist with maintaining a safe and secure environment in the YATC building, including monitoring the front door and greeting visitors.
- Daily support and communication with ordering and receiving student meal services.
- Maintain an up-to-date "Emergency Contact Forms" binder for the YATC caseload and staff and maintain "Go-Bag" supplies.
- Change voicemail greetings for the holidays, office closings, staff-meetings, and summer hours.
- Assist YATC staff with special events, student picture day, conferences, and professional development days.
- Assist with mailings/special projects for the YATC Team, Pathfinder Principal, or Executive Administration Assistant.
- Scan and upload documents into Kelvin/IEP system on time, ensuring signature pages are included.
- Maintain and share, as needed, the list of student caseloads to ancillary staff.
- Collaborate with local district personnel as needed.
- Utilize the ISD Transportation system to submit transportation requests for YATC outings and community-based activities.
- Utilize the ISD system to submit and follow up on Facilities Maintenance requests.
- Utilize the ISD room reservation systems to reserve conference rooms when needed, including paper and ink supplies for printer/copier.
- Provide light technical/technology support.
- Enter and maintain necessary information in the Pathfinder calendar.
- Coordinate and execute safety drills in collaboration with the Principal, Pathfinder Executive Administrative Assistant and the ISD Facilities Manager.
- Ensure office supplies are available, organized and ordered when needed.
- Receive student medications and complete required paperwork for processing and assist with administration if needed.
- Collaborate with supervisors and other office assistants to ensure coverage when absent.
- Participate in yearly CPI and biyearly CPR/AED and First Aid Training.
- Assist and back up ISD office assistants as needed.
- Perform other duties as assigned by St. Joseph County ISD Administration.
Reports to: Special Education Principal
PERFORMANCE APPRAISALS: Special Education Principal
TERMS OF EMPLOYMENT: A 191-day position/7-hours per day. Salary and conditions of employment are determined by the Board of Education.
